FSBO means “For Sale By Owner.” You sell your property directly without hiring a listing agent—saving thousands in commission.

Professional agents may charge 3–6% in commission. On a $300,000 home, that’s $9,000–$18,000. You only pay us if we bring a buyer and sell your house.

Use a Comparative Market Analysis (CMA) based on recent SOLD homes. Pricing just below a major bracket (like $299,900 instead of $305,000) can attract more buyers. At a minimum:
1. A purchase agreement
2. Seller’s property disclosure
3. Lead-based paint disclosure (if built before 1978)
4. State-specific legal documents
